    Abstract: A display device controller has digital RGB colour signal lines and horizontal and vertical sync signal lines (7, 8). NAND gates (9) detect in respect of at least one of the RGB colour signal lines when the digital signal on that line corresponds to a black level, and a D/A converter (10) and an adder (+) add to at least one of the horizontal and vertical sync signal lines a signal corresponding to the black level signal so detected.

    Abstract: PURPOSE: To provide a means for exactly displaying black at a place where black should be displayed, and displaying a further clear color picture in the display device of a computer. CONSTITUTION: This controller for a display device is connected with a display device through R, G, and B color information signal lines 4, and horizontal and vertical synchronizing signals 7 and 8, is provided with a means 9 for fetching a black information signal in which N bits are defined as a prescribed pattern from at least one of the R, G, and B color information signal lines 4 constituted of N bit digital signals, and a means for superimposing the fetched black information signal on at least one of the horizontal and vertical synchronizing signals 7 and 8.

    Abstract: PURPOSE: To minimize variation in high voltage on the output line of a flyback transformer by using compensation voltage pulses of a 2nd frequency higher than a 1st frequency supplied to the flyback transformer. CONSTITUTION: A control circuit 2 is triggered with a horizontal synchronizing pulse and its output is sent to a horizontal deflecting circuit 3, whose output passes through the flyback transformer FBT 11 and a diode 13 to charge a smoothing capacitor 12, so that a high DC voltage is generated on an output line 14 and supplied to the anode 15 of a CRT. Pulses of 70kHz are made into a pulse train 140kHz by a multiplexing circuit 17 and the pulse train is applied to a compensation circuit 18. The circuit 18 responds to an error signal from an error detector 21 and a compensation voltage is applied to a point 28 between capacitors 12 and 20 through a transformer 19. An LPF 29 is connected to the point 28 and FBT 11 and the compensation voltage is applied to the FBT 11.

    Abstract: PROBLEM TO BE SOLVED: To provide an information processor in which adjusting effect of a viewing angle width is improved by controlling gradation of a liquid crystal display (LCD) device, a display control method, and a program for executing the display control method with which a viewing angle characteristic is controlled.
    SOLUTION: The information processor includes second software for forwarding display control of the LCD panel from a CPU 12 to first software after receiving a display mode change instruction, and a plurality of display control table 38 in which color pallet data of less than 128 gradation levels are allocated with degeneration for a higher gradation level. From an identification data of the LCD panel which is acquired by the first or the second software to which the control is forwarded, a degeneration color conversion table corresponding to the identification data is retrieved. A display adapter 30 reads out the degeneration color conversion table retrieved from a display control table storing section 36 to a look-up-table (LUT) reading section 40 and generates an RGB signal in which the gradation is degenerated.

    Abstract: PROBLEM TO BE SOLVED: To provide a display device and information processor which enable a user to properly set easiness of viewing a screen and a trade-off for lower power consumption. SOLUTION: The display device 200 equipped with a panel 230 where pixels are arrayed in matrix comprises a mode setting part 240 for setting one of a plurality of display modes of the display device 200, a voltage supply part 250 which varies a driving voltage as a reference voltage for a voltage to be supplied to the panel 230 according to the display mode set by the mode setting part 240, a gate driver 260 which supplies a selection signal to a plurality of pixels arrayed in a column direction on the panel 230, and a source driver 270 which supplies a pixel driving voltage generated based on luminance data specifying the luminance of a plurality of pixels selected by the selection signal and the driving voltage to the plurality of selected pixels.     Abstract: PROBLEM TO BE SOLVED: To provide a liquid crystal display device and a computer system by which power consumption can effectively be reduced. SOLUTION: A refresh rate is changed in accordance with the changing of the brightness of an LCD(liquid crystal display) panel, and when the brightness of the LCD panel is lowered, the refresh rate is changed. It is judged whether the power source of the display device is an AC power source or a DC power source by judging whether an AC adaptor is connected to the device or not, and when the power source of the device is the DC power source, the brightness and refresh rate of the LCD panel are lowered than those at the time the power source of the device is the AC power source.

    Abstract: PURPOSE: To lower the source voltage of a final-stage amplifier, to reduce heat generation and electromagnetic wave radiation, and to improve the reliability by performing cutoff adjustment, luminance adjustment, etc., of a CRT by a clump circuit which is separated from the final-stage amplifier in term of direct current. CONSTITUTION: The source voltage B1 of the final-stage amplifier 5 is only high enough to secure the dynamic range needed for the reference DC level of an analog video signal after amplification and the analog video signal to be amplified. Then the cutoff adjustment of the CRT is made by applying a DC voltage to the base (C point) of a transistor 28 by a variable resistor 26 and the luminance adjustment of the CRT screen is made by applying a control voltage to the base (A point) of a transistor 27. Eventually, the cutoff adjustment, luminance adjustment, etc., of the CRT are made by controlling the clamp voltage of the clamp circuit 19 separated from the final-stage amplifier 5 in terms of direct current. Therefore, the source voltage of the final-stage amplifier 5 is reducible approximately to a half as high as usual.

    Abstract: PURPOSE: To control the luminance of information on a screen whose luminance is adjusted by contrast adjustment so that it does not exceed prescribed maximum luminance when background luminance is increased by brightness adjustment, to prevent the fluctuation of background luminance and to hold gradation luminance information. CONSTITUTION: The signal amplification rate of an input video signal is adjusted by a contrast adjustment variable resistor 4. The black level of white luminance at the background is adjusted by a brightness adjustment variable resistor 11. A transmission conversion circuit 12 receives adjustment values by the variable resistors 4 and 11 as inputs, and generate two values with the adjustment values as parameters. It is detected whether the total value of the two values exceeds a prescribed value corresponding to maximum luminance which is previously decided on the display screen. When it does not exceed the value, contrast is not readjusted. When it exceeds the value, the amplification rate of the amplifier 3 is reduced so that the maximum luminance of the video signal does not exceed the maximum luminance level of CRT, which is previously decided.
